And, in fact, yesterday I talked about something that I frankly have not heard anybody else talk about. Maybe you have. but I went into some depths talking about these wise men. You know, the Bible doesn't say there were three. That's a tradition. The Bible just says wise men. Now, I, Guess people have, have concluded that because they brought three basic gifts, gold, frankincense and myrrh, that one brought gold, one brought frankincense, one brought myrrh. But it doesn't say that. That's just something that people have, have sort of imposed upon the text. I really believe that there was a caravan of, wise men, probably a school of them that were students of scripture who, who God could really get to. Because they were so immersed in the Word, God was really able to get to them and speak to them. They didn't discover that star. You know, God revealed that star to them and God commanded that star to guide them. and they had to go through the, the Arabian desert and all kinds of dangerous terrain. And based upon the scriptural, timetable, they may have been traveling for a year. That wouldn't have, the normal case, taken them a year to go, say from Persia or somewhere in one of these eastern regions. but it would have taken them at least a few months, in the normal course. But I really believe that God had them on a timetable to arrive at just the right time. And, and look, they arrived and were called in to see Herod. You know, Herod the Great was one of the most brutal, bloodthirsty, tyrants that ever ruled over Judea. You know, he killed three of his own children because he thought they might be three of his own sons because he thought they might be a threat to his, his kingship. He killed his, his wife, he killed his wife's parents, son in law, and, and, and then killed who knows how many countless others because he was truly a blood thirsty man. but he was very, very prominent. They called him Herod the Great. I mean, he personally knew Mark Anthony, he personally knew Cleopatra, he personally knew Caesar Augustus. He's a very powerful man. Caller: Thank you for taking my call. Bishop, I wanted to make sure that you knew that. No, the idea of intelligent life on other planets does not come from evolution. two hundred and nine years before Charles Darwin was born, and 259 years before Charles Darwin's book was written, Giordano Bruno was burned at the stake for saying that there could be people living on some other planets. Also, early Christian writers, including Augustine, discussed ideas from thinkers like Democritus and Epicurus about countless worlds in the vast universe.
